forked from oceanprotocol/provider
-
Notifications
You must be signed in to change notification settings - Fork 0
/
tox.ini
31 lines (29 loc) · 1.1 KB
/
tox.ini
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
[tox]
envlist = py36
[travis]
python =
3.6: py36
[testenv]
whitelist_externals = cp
passenv = *
setenv =
PYTHONPATH = {toxinidir}
CONFIG_FILE = {toxinidir}/config_local.ini
AUTH_TOKEN_EXPIRATION=3153600000
PROVIDER_PRIVATE_KEY=0xc594c6e5def4bab63ac29eed19a134c130388f74f019bc74b8f4389df2837a58
TEST_PRIVATE_KEY1=0xef4b441145c1d0f3b4bc6d61d29f5c6e502359481152f869247c7a4244d45209
TEST_PRIVATE_KEY2=0x5d75837394b078ce97bc289fa8d75e21000573520bfa7784a9d28ccaae602bf8
OPERATOR_SERVICE_URL=https://operator-api.operator.dev-ocean.com
ARTIFACTS_PATH=~/.ocean/ocean-contracts/artifacts
ADDRESS_FILE=~/.ocean/ocean-contracts/artifacts/address.json
deps =
-r{toxinidir}/requirements_dev.txt
; If you want to make tox run the tests with the same versions, create a
; requirements.txt with the pinned versions and uncomment the following line:
; -r{toxinidir}/requirements.txt
commands =
cp {toxinidir}/config.ini {toxinidir}/config_local.ini
pip install -U pip
coverage run --source ocean_provider -m py.test -s --basetemp={envtmpdir}
coverage report
coverage xml